Llevant is a region in eastern Mallorca, defined by its varied and largely undeveloped landscapes. The area features rugged mountains, including the Serra de Llevant range, alongside unspoiled coastlines with secluded coves. Inland, diverse Mediterranean ecosystems encompass pine forests, holm oak groves, and rural valleys. This geographical composition provides a setting for several sports like hiking, road cycling, jogging, touring cycling, and more.

The Llevant region features rugged mountains like Talaia Freda (1,850 feet / 564 m) and Bec de Ferrutx (1,700 feet / 519 m), offering panoramic views. It also includes unspoiled coastlines with secluded beaches such as Cala Torta and Cala Mitjana. Diverse Mediterranean ecosystems with pine forests and holm oak groves are also present.

The landscape of Llevant includes historical elements such as old stone walls, traditional farmhouses, and watchtowers. The historic Camí dels Presos, an old road built by prisoners of war, also adds a cultural dimension to outdoor explorations in the region.
